Drawbridge Operation Regulation; New Jersey Intracoastal Waterway 
(NJICW), Atlantic City, NJ

AGENCY: Coast Guard, DHS.

ACTION: Notice of deviation from drawbridge regulation.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------

SUMMARY: The Coast Guard has issued a temporary deviation from the 
operating schedule that governs the US Route 30 (Absecon Boulevard) 
Bridge across Beach Thorofare, NJICW mile 67.2, and the US Route 40-322 
(Albany Avenue) bridge across Inside Thorofare, NJICW mile 70.0, both 
at Atlantic City, NJ. The deviation is necessary to accommodate the 
egress of vehicles following two concert events. This deviation allows 
the bridge to remain in the closed to

[[Page 40638]]

navigation position to permit the free movement of vehicles during two 
separate Beach Country concerts.

DATES: This deviation is effective from 8 p.m. to 10 p.m. on Thursday 
July 31, 2014 and from 8 p.m. to 10 p.m. on Sunday August 3, 2014.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The New Jersey Department of Transportation 
requested a temporary deviation from the current operating regulations 
of the US Route 30 (Absecon Boulevard) Bridge across Beach Thorofare, 
NJICW mile 67.2 and the US40-322 (Albany Avenue) across Inside 
Thorofare, NJICW mile 70.0, both at Atlantic City, NJ. The temporary 
deviation has been requested to ensure the safety of the heavy numbers 
of pedestrians and vehicular traffic that would be transiting over the 
bridges for the two concerts at Bader Field located within the city 
limits.

Route 30/Absecon Boulevard Bridge

    The current operating regulation for this bridge is outlined fully 
in 33 CFR 117.733(e). During the requested closure period for the 
event, the draw would be required to open on the hour. In the closed 
position to vessels, the vertical clearance for this bascule-type 
bridge is 20 feet, above mean high water.

US40-322 (Albany Avenue) Bridge

    The current operating regulation for this bridge is outlined fully 
in 33 CFR 117.733(f). During the requested closure period for the 
event, the draw would be required to open on the hour and half hour 
from 6 p.m. to 9 p.m. and open on demand from between 9 p.m. to 10 p.m. 
In the closed position to vessels, the vertical clearance for this 
bascule-type bridge is 10 feet, above mean high water.
    Under this temporary deviation both bridges will be closed, from 8 
p.m. to 10 p.m. on Thursday July 31, 2014 and from 8 p.m. to 10 p.m. on 
Sunday August 3, 2014. Between the dates of the two closure periods the 
bridges shall return to their regular operating schedules.
    The majority of the vessels that transit the bridges this time of 
the year are recreational boats. Vessels able to pass through the 
bridges in the closed positions may do so at anytime. Both bridges will 
be able to open for emergencies. The Atlantic Ocean is an alternate 
route for vessels unable to pass through the bridges in closed 
positions. The Coast Guard will also inform the users of the waterways 
through our Local and Broadcast Notices to Mariners of the closure 
periods for the bridge so that vessels can arrange their transits to 
minimize any impact caused by the temporary deviation.
    In accordance with 33 CFR 117.35(e), the drawbridge must return to 
its regular operating schedule immediately at the end of the effective 
period of this temporary deviation. This deviation from the operating 
regulations is authorized under 33 CFR 117.35.
